#716b49 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#716b49 is composed of 44.3% red, 42%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.3% magenta, 35.4%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 51 degrees, a saturation of 21.5% and a lightness of 36.5%. #716b49 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2d692 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#716b49 color description : Very dark desaturated yellow.
#716b49 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#716b49 has RGB values of R:113, G:107,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.35,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7433033.

Shades and Tints of #716b49
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060504 is the darkest color, while #fbfbf9 is the lightest one.
